Precisely what is an Unexpected emergency Quit Button?
An emergency cease button, generally referred to as an E-stop, is a security product installed on machinery that enables an operator or bystander to speedily and easily halt the equipment's operation during a hazardous situation. The E-end button is typically massive, crimson, and simply obtainable, making certain swift identification in emergencies. When pressed, it instantly cuts ability into the equipment, stopping all mechanical processes.

Vital Capabilities of an Crisis End Drive Button
Large and visual Style and design: The crisis quit force button is typically designed to be substantial and brightly coloured (generally red using a yellow history), rendering it very easy to Track down during the occasion of the crisis. Its prominent design and style ensures that it could be activated immediately without having confusion or hold off.

Drive-to-Split Operation: Most crisis prevent buttons work on the press-to-break mechanism, which means that pressing the button breaks the electrical circuit, shutting down the equipment. This design and style is usually a fall short-Secure, ensuring that pressing the button will immediately prevent all functions.

Latching Mechanism: The moment pressed, the unexpected emergency cease push button switch ordinarily locks into area, necessitating a manual reset before the equipment is often restarted. This stops accidental reactivation of the equipment just before the specific situation continues to be fully assessed and deemed safe.

IP Score for Longevity: In industrial environments, emergency stop buttons are often subjected to harsh situations, which include dust, drinking water, and mechanical effects. Consequently, They are really built to meet different Ingress Security (IP) scores, making sure they are proof against environmental components and continue to operate in adverse circumstances.

Emergency Stop Button Expectations and Polices
Emergency stop buttons should adhere to rigid security rules, which fluctuate by sector and emergency stop push button switch region. Worldwide expectations for example ISO 13850 and IEC 60947-five-5 offer suggestions for the design, shade, placement, and operation of unexpected emergency cease devices. These benchmarks support be sure that emergency cease programs are uniform, trusted, and simply recognizable.
